Yesterday, I (Alexandra) had the privilege of attending and speaking at the 5th annual AFIRE conference held in Scottsdale Arizona. This conference brings together a group of real estate’s leading women to create a three day networking experience. It covers “the latest in technology, hot issues that will influence us now and in the future, what’s happening on the international scene, strategies for working across generations, and most importantly, how to create and maintain a positive attitude. (2011 program notes).”
